Ways You Can Help the COVID-19 Relief

Foundation clients of Howland Capital are turning their focus to address the COVID-19 crisis by providing critical support to organizations serving the community. In this time of need, it can be challenging to identify how giving will directly impact those who need it most. Below are some suggestions from Kate Grundy, our Vice President of Foundation Services:

• In Boston, The Boston Foundation has initiated a response here:

https://www.tbf.org/what-we-do/special-funds/covid-19-response-fund

• The City of Boston has created the Boston Resiliency Fund to provide food to children and seniors, technology for remote learning, and support to first responders and healthcare workers in Boston.
https://www.boston.gov/departments/treasury/boston-resiliency-fund

• Philanthropy Massachusetts has assembled a wide range of opportunities to help others across Massachusetts. It is available on their website:

https://philanthropyma.org/grantmakers-philanthropic-advisors/resources/disaster-and-emergency-relief-resources

Similar efforts are happening across the country. Look to your local Community Foundation or United Way, many of which have launched COVID-19 funds to support those most affected by the virus response.
